In the dead of night, Jonathan sat in his dimly lit room, the only illumination coming from the glow of his computer screen. The game of Snake and Mouse was an old, childhood favorite, but tonight, something felt off. As he guided the snake through the maze, the mouse seemed to move with a mind of its own, dodging his every attempt to catch it.
The air grew colder, and the shadows in the room seemed to lengthen, creeping toward him. Jonathan's heart pounded as he noticed the snake on the screen morphing, its eyes glowing red. The mouse, usually a simple prey, now bore sharp fangs and a sinister grin.
Suddenly, a message flashed on the screen: "The hunt is on." Before Jonathan could react, a chill ran down his spine as a whisper echoed in his ear, "Will you be the hunter... or the hunted?"
